Qualifications to possess an excellent Virtual assistant Financing
To locate recognition for Virtual assistant financing, individuals need to pay awareness of numerous qualification criteria about Agency out of Experts Items (VA) additionally the bank and get a valid certificate from Qualifications (COE).
- Your serviced 181 times of active services during the peacetime;
- Your served 90 successive months into the effective service through the wartime;
- Your offered six decades regarding the National Shield otherwise Supplies or possess ninety days from service (at least 31 of those consecutively) significantly less than Label thirty-two requests;
- You’re companion regarding a support representative exactly who died while offering otherwise on account of a help-relevant handicap.
Money Standards getting a great Va Mortgage
Va financing money criteria are one of the main items affecting borrowers’ value for Va funds. When making an application for even more fund, loan providers should be sure you can make their monthly homeloan payment on time. They pay attention to your own gross income the amount you have made before write-offs so you’re able to determine your debt-to-money proportion (DTI).
Loan providers look at your residual income, and thus the amount left from the income following homeloan payment, possessions taxes, home insurance, federal and state withholdings, and you will debt burden taken from the terrible monthly earnings.

The fresh new Service out-of Pros Circumstances (VA) is not a loan provider and does not bring money. Instead, it cooperates with multiple Virtual assistant loan providers that may give you the necessary amount borrowed. All of the Virtual assistant lender possesses its own standards, and you should examine them to get a hold of a choice with the absolute most beneficial financing name and the reduced estimated rate of interest. Monthly Loans Money
Your month-to-month personal debt money gamble an essential character on the home’s affordability. Loan providers tune in to their big monthly bills, mostly towards funds dysfunction expenses. The reduced their total month-to-month financial obligation payments, the greater your acceptance window of opportunity for good Va loan.
You might see your position that have expenses, as well as your finances-cracking costs, of the calculating the debt-to-money ratio (DTI). An effective DTI measures up your biggest month-to-month debt payments towards gross monthly earnings. No matter if taking a good Va loan is easier if the DTI was at most 41%, there aren’t any rigid conditions having obtaining the funding.
